Coach Acker said despite the final score his Tiger basketball squad competed very well against a tough Westlake team. Westlake is tied for the district lead with Lake Travis with 10-1 records. The Tigers could not stay up as Westlake held an advantage in each quarter and lost the game 63-41. It was 16-11 after one and 33-21 at the half. The third ended 49-35
Scoring for the Tigers were Grant Gillum 10, Rushton Budge 9, Grant Reagan 5, A’myron Hurst 4, Isaac Terry 4, Maddox Lacopo 4, Harrison Hight 3, Liam Lawson 2. Rebs: Budge 7, Lawson 4, Hight 3, Terry 3. Assts: Budge 2, Reagan 2, Solomon Igharo 2.
